Srinagar: The services of Dial 112 saved a family which had been stranded in the forests of Bangus Valley, and was subsequently rescued by a joint team of police and army, police spokesman informed Monday.

He said Dial-112 received a distress call yesterday informing that one Atiq-ul-Rahman and his family members including five women and five small children (total 11 persons) had gone to Bangus valley in Kupwara for picnic but had lost way while returning through Upper Rajwar Wader Bala route towards Handwara. Their vehicle had got stuck and was unable to move any further, police said.

On being informed about the case, Police Post Zachaldara along with the troops of Army’s 21RR launched a rescue operation and successfully tracked the stranded family, and shifted it to the Police Post Zachaldara for night. Their stuck vehicle was towed from the spot by a JCB arranged by the police, police spokesman said, adding that they were later escorted to the main road where-from they resumed their journey to home.
